.pagination{/*分页*/
    text-align: center;
    font-size: .14rem;
    padding-bottom: .2rem;
}
.pagination a{
    width: .32rem;
    line-height: .32rem;
    display: inline-block;
    text-align: center;
    background: #eee;
    border-radius: .03rem;
    margin: 0 .06rem;
}
.pagination .first-page,.pagination .last-page,.pagination .yj-pga8,.pagination .yj-pga0{
    width: auto;
    padding: 0 .15rem;
}
.pagination .active{
    background: #1b5cbd;
    color: #fff;
}
@media screen and (min-width: 769px){
    .pagination a:hover{
        background: #2760b7;
        color: #fff;
        cursor:pointer;
    }
}
@media screen and (max-width: 768px){
    .pagination { /*分页*/
        font-size: .28rem;
        padding-bottom: .3rem;
    }
    .pagination a{
        width: .5rem;
        line-height: .5rem;
        border-radius: .03rem;
        margin: 0 .06rem;
    }
    .pagination .first-page,.pagination .last-page,.pagination .yj-pga8,.pagination .yj-pga0{
        padding: 0 .2rem;
        display: none;
    }
}
